- [ ] **Step 7: Breaker override escrow.** After sealing the signing keys for the Tallgrove upstream API circuit breaker, confirm the support team can force the breaker open during a full outage. The override bundle lives in the sealed escrow drawer and is useless without its unlock phrase. Two ceremony witnesses must initial this step before proceeding. The escrow bundle is decrypted with the recovery passphrase that follows.

vault phrase of kahip-kahop = holath-quenmir

// Heads up, support crew: we're mid-migration from the old
// Makefile soup to Hearthforge, our hermetic build system.
// Builds now run in sandboxed containers, so "works on my
// machine" tickets should drop off. If a customer build fails
// with a sandbox error, grab the trace from the Hearthforge
// cache service — don't ask them to rebuild locally.
// This client pulls those traces automatically. It connects
// to the cache service using the key below.

service key, kaduf-bawig: kto15_Ze79S0dligTw0yO

Heads up for the Quarrel Gate review: our config hot-reload watcher in CI sometimes picks up half-written files when the Bramblewick runner flushes slowly, so you'll see spurious validation failures that look like tampering. They're not. We now write to a temp file and atomically rename, which closed the gap. If you want to verify the fix yourself, rerun the reload job and check the emitted token, which appears directly under this note.

pipeline stamp: htk31_f769b577b3028a4e9958e5bb8d1259a

Ticket: GC-pause tuning vault locked for the Pairloom matching service. The vault holds the heap profiles and JVM flag sets used to reproduce the 800ms stop-the-world pauses from last quarter. Future maintainers will need these artifacts before touching allocator settings. Unlock via the Wrenfold ops console using the service's recovery flow, then enter the passphrase shown below.

unlock words, hahip-baduf: holwyn-istath-julvan